A sharp bat… Hitting genius Lee Jung-hoo returns to his place

Lee Jung-hoo (24), the core of the Kiwoom Heroes attack, is finding his place. The bat turns fiercely in July as well.

Last winter, Lee Jung-hoo modified his batting form. Ahead of the challenge in the Major League (MLB), changes were made for quick response to the ball and concise swing.

In the end, Lee Jung-hoo chose to return to batting form, and showed signs of revival in May. He appeared in 26 games and he had a batting average of 0.305 OPS and 0.784. Starting from May 27th, Lee Jeong-hoo raised the pace by making multi-hits in 4 consecutive games.

Last month, Lee Jung-hoo announced the return of a batting genius. In 24 games last month, he had a batting average of 0.374, 2 home runs and 14 RBIs. OPS broke through 1.0 at 1.046.

Here, Lee Jung-hoo succeeded in entering the 30% for the first time in his season and maintained a high-sensitivity hitting feeling, recording an accurate batting average of 0.300 on the last day of June. Recognized for his performance, Lee Jung-hoo was even nominated for the KBO League Monthly MVP in June.

In July, the water rose properly. On the 1st, against the SSG Landers in Gocheok, Lee Jung-hoo announced a fresh start by performing a batting show with 4 hits and 2 RBIs in 4 at-bats, and scored 3 hits in the home game against the NC Dinos on the 5th.

Lee Jung-hoo, who showed a good flow, hit 40% (4 hits in 10 at-bats) in 3 consecutive matches against the Doosan Bears last weekend, and recorded the highest batting average of this season, 0.315, ahead of the last 3 consecutive matches in the first half. Moreover, as of the 11th, he vomited up the spirit of becoming tied for second place (100 hits) in the hit category.

Lee Jung-hoo is about to end the first half with his hitting feeling perfectly restored. His second half is also a positive sign that we can expect his batting condition to improve. It is a valuable income for Kiwoom, who is fighting a bloody middle-ranking battle. Naturally, the gaze is focused on Lee Jung-hoo’s second half.
